titleOfInvention Public key encryption device
abstract To realize an encryption method using a number sequence that is a public key of knapsack encryption as a complete random number sequence. SOLUTION: For I (I ≧ 3) private keys ei-1, I private keys Pi (ei-1 and Pi are relatively prime), a number n representing the dimension of a vector, and modulus Z In the public key memory, there are I dimensional public key vectors ai whose components are 0 or more and less than Pi and n dimensional public key vectors bj whose components are 0 or more and less than Z (J is 2 or more). Remember. A random number generator and an arithmetic unit generate I-dimensional random number vectors ri whose components are 0 or more and less than Z and n-dimensional J random number plaintext vectors vj whose components are 0 or more and less than Z. The checker checks whether m≡Σj = 1... Jbj · vj (modZ) is established for plaintext m. If not, random number vector ri and random plaintext vector vj are regenerated. The operation unit generates I ciphertexts Ci having Ci = ai · ri. [Selection] Figure 1
